Combate Americas ‘Combate Estrellas 1’ Gets New Main Event for Friday’s Card in Los Angeles
There have been several changes to Friday’s Combate Americas card, including a revision to the bantamweight main event.

Meanwhile, the mixed martial arts debut of five-division boxing world champion Amanda Serrano will come against a new foe in the co-main event. Serrano’s original opponent, Erendira Ordonez was unable to secure a work visa for the fight, so she will be replaced by Corina Herrera.
Finally, Rudy Morales will step in for the injured Pablo Sabori and face Jose Estrada in the evening’s first televised main card bout.
“Combate Estrellas 1” will be televised on Univision (12 a.m. ET/12 a.m. PT) and Univision Deportes (12 a.m. ET/9 p.m. PT). The event marks the first live MMA broadcast on Univision Deportes.
